Just how Often Should You Take Your Canine To The Vet in Kewell VIC?

Normally, if you have a healthy and balanced dog, it would only require to see you local Kewell veterinarian at least once every twelve months for a basic check-up. Nevertheless, it is rather different for new pups and also older canines.

New young puppies will certainly require several visits to the veterinarian in their initial 6 months. They will certainly require to check up with the veterinarian for their first exam, puppy vaccinations, heartworm (plus flea and tick) prevention, and for neutering. Whilst, elderly canines over 7 years will certainly need at least two appointments annually.

What Are The Different Kinds of Vet Hospitals in Kewell VIC?

In one sentence, a vet is essentially an animal physician. There are numerous kinds of veterinarians in Kewell VIC but listed here are the 5 main kinds of veterinarians.

Companion pet vets: Vets that work with companion pets like dogs and also pet cats.

Livestock vets: Vets who work with tamed stock.

Exotic pet vets: Vets who usually work with reptiles, birds and small mammals like rodents and ferrets.

Mixed practice veterinarians: Veterinarians who deal with both little and large pets.

Lab animal medicine veterinarians: Vets who work in laboratories that are in charge of the health of a variety of pets on account of science.

Microchipping Canines and Pet Cats

Microchipping of cats and pet dogs involve injecting a tiny microchip with an unique code that is connected to a Animal ID Register. Microchip for animals are securely injected under your pet’s skin. If your pet dog or cat were to get lost, a local government ranger for Kewell or Kewell vet will certainly have the ability to check your family pet’s microchip and gain access to your contact details to get in touch with you.

Cat and Pet Dog Cardiology Care

Heart troubles in pets and pet cats are more prevalent as they get older nevertheless it is not an unusual health and wellness condition for animals of any ages. Your feline or dog might call for a heart test if they have the following signs and symptoms of heart troubles in dogs and cats: uncommon heart beats, heart murmurs, respiratory system grievances, fainting, exercise intolerance, and also weak point. Pet Cat and Dog Oral Cleansing and Examinations

Normal dental cleaning and also check-ups on your pet cats and also canines will help to identify any indications of dental condition as well as will certainly enable your Kewell veterinarian to discuss what oral monitoring program would be best for your pet cat or pet. Common signs and symptoms of oral disease in canines and also pet cats include halitosis, loosened teeth, discoloured teeth, facial swelling, extreme salivating as well as a lot more.
